Five Die As Trailer Crashes Into Commercial Bus In Edo

Jane OkoroBy Jane OkoroSeptember 26, 20232 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it WhatsApp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p Email

LAGOS, Nigeria (VOICE OF NAIJA)- No fewer than 15 persons have been killed after a trailer rammed into a commercial bus in Etsako East Local Government Area of Edo State.

The Trailer was said to be coming from Lokoja-Okene road before ramming into the commercial bus that was full of passengers.

According to an eyewitness, the incident occurred after the trailer had a brake failure and crashed into a Toyota bus, killing 15 persons.

The source also disclosed that the corpses of the deceased were taken to the mortuary, while the injured were immediately taken to the hospital for medical attention.

Efforts to reach the State Sector Commander of the Federal Road Safety Corps, Paul Okpe, were not successful, as the commander was unavailable at the time of filing this report.

Meanwhile, the Etsako East Local Chairman, Hon. Benedicta Attoh, has commiserated with the families of the victims, as well as the people of Okpella, on the tragic incident.

A statement from her Chief Press Secretary, Ben Atu, said she sincerely sympathises with the family of the dead and prays for a quick recovery for the injured.

The statement reads in part, “It is with a deep sense of sorrow that I commiserate with the families of those that lost their lives in a fatal motor accident along the Ewo Market Road in Okpella.

“On behalf of Etsako East Local Government Council, I extend our heartfelt condolences to the families of our departed brothers and sisters.

“May God grant the families and loved ones the fortitude to bear the irreparable loss and may their souls rest in peace, amen,” she said.
